What is the difference between standard height and chair height toilet?

A standard height toilet is about 15 inches from floor to seat, and a chair height toilet is about 17 to 19 inches from the bottom to the seat. The best toilet height depends on you and your family’s height. Let us explain more about standard height and chair height toilets.

Standard Height Toilet:

The toilet height is from the floor, and the standard toilet height is 15 inches from the floor, which is 2 or 3 inches shorter than the chair height toilet. The standard height toilet is perfect and popular for shorter people, such as children, adults, and normal-sized people. These toilets are primarily used in older bathrooms.

Now you can also change the height of a standard toilet through a toilet riser. If you have a standard toilet and want to change its height, buy a riser. That will add several inches to your toilet height and boost the height like a chair height toilet without changing the whole toilet and investing hundreds of dollars.

Chair height toilet:

The chair toilet height is 17 to 19 inches which is 2 or 3 inches longer than standard height toilets. These toilets are popular with tall people, which gives more comfort to tall women and men. While in standard height toilets, a tall person may struggle to sit down and stand up, so the extra 3 inches will give more comfort. 

The chair height toilets are for comfort purposes. The chair height toilet is a famous name that every brand is using. They are well known from several names such as comfort height, universal height, and suitable height toilets.

Flush options

The flushing option is an essential factor to see before selecting the toilet because flushing depends on toilet cleaning. Different types of flushing are necessary for you to know.

Gravity flushing toilet

In traditional bathrooms, we see gravity flushing toilets. This is one of the standard flushing toilets which uses gravity. The water from the tank falls on the waste in a bowl to clean the debris for easy flushing through gravity. 

This system uses a lot of water and performs quitter work compared to other flush options. Everyone should be familiar with this gravity flushing system. But the gravity flushing system is slower than others, which may not be able to clean the bowl perfectly.

Pressure assisted toilet

These flushing systems are familiar to the gravity flushing system. If you want a flushing system like gravity but to work a bit faster, go for a pressure-assist toilet. These flush used in commercial spaces because of their cost. The pressure assist toilets are expensive, and performing clean and faster work also uses less water. 

But now, it also operates in homes and is best for larger families. But this system is noisy and the loudest one, if you don’t have any problem with the flushing noise, then this is perfect for you.

Dual flushing toilet

The dual flushing toilet has provided both gravity and pressure-assist toilet systems. These are the best options for water-saving. Through this system, you can save a lot of water without worrying about an extra flush.

Q. What are the ADA regulations for comfort height toilets?

The toilet from the floor seat height must be between 17 to 18 inches. For children, the height of a bowl must be between 11 to 15 inches from the floor. Must have enough space created between the wall of the toilet to easily the user of wheelchair transitioning. At the same time, the area must be 45 inches between the toilet walls.

Q. Is a chair height toilet taller than standard?

Yes, the chair heights are 2 or 3 inches taller than standard height toilets. The chair height toilet has 17 to 19 inches height from the floor, while the standard height toilet has 15 inches height.

Q. What are one-piece and two-piece toilets?

The two toilet tank and bowl pieces come separately, while the one-piece toilet comes with an attached bowl and tank. The one-piece toilet is a unique design, while the two-piece toilet is common, which is used everywhere. 

While the installation of both methods regarding difficult, the two-piece installation is easy to move and maneuver, but they need to be bolted together. And the one-piece is hard to move but doesn’t require assembling.
